psslurs.pro (PS-slurs type K) depends on dvips very deeply.
No other dviwares nor pdfTeX can produce the desired result.
Simply use dvips as far as you use PS-slurs type K.

Otherwise, disable PS-slurs during testing and previewing.

PS-slurs type M even can work on dviout, however, I do not recommend 
using dviout *for the purpose of PS-slurs M*.  For details, see the bottom of 
http://homepage1.nifty.com/kuuku/pub/musixtex/musixpss/musixpss-hints-e.html

Note that dviout is designed mainly for normal writing a text/article/book
with some inclusion of already-finished drawings.
